Transaction 34c94b18d899ce756093785785c8305a151cd54ce373bac09ebfb198e36f3177

1 Input
2 Outputs
  • 34c94b18d899ce756093785785c8305a151cd54ce373bac09ebfb198e36f3177:0
  • value  27758645
    address  bc1qf3p9x4lt68v29jns37005y087hx7wxr0x75sr3
  • 34c94b18d899ce756093785785c8305a151cd54ce373bac09ebfb198e36f3177:1
  • value  628805
    address  1KBXxSVisDuhhXVpfzXaFWaqNMVc6PEbhJ